What are some common challenges faced by professionals in remote human factors research roles?

One common challenge in remote human factors research is effectively replicating real-world environments and user interactions when participants are not physically present. This can require creative use of digital tools for remote usability testing and careful planning to ensure data quality. Additionally, coordinating with cross-functional teams and participants across different time zones can require strong communication and organizational skills. Despite these challenges, remote roles provide flexibility and access to a broader range of research participants, which can enrich the research process.

What is remote human factors research?

Remote human factors research is the study of how people interact with systems, products, or environments, conducted from a distance rather than in-person. Researchers use digital tools such as online surveys, video calls, and remote usability testing platforms to collect data and observe participant behavior. This approach allows for gathering insights from diverse geographic locations and can be more flexible and cost-effective than traditional in-person methods. Remote research is especially useful for studying user experience, ergonomics, and human-computer interaction in real-world settings.

What is the difference between Remote Human Factors Research vs Remote User Experience Research?

AspectRemote Human Factors ResearchRemote User Experience Research
CredentialsTypically requires degrees in psychology, human factors, or ergonomicsOften requires degrees in psychology, design, or human-computer interaction
Work EnvironmentConducts studies to improve safety, usability, and performance in various settingsFocuses on enhancing user satisfaction and interface usability for digital products
Industry UsageUsed across healthcare, aviation, automotive, and industrial sectorsPrimarily used in tech, software, and digital product companies

Remote Human Factors Research and Remote User Experience Research share overlapping skills and credentials but differ in focus. Human Factors Research emphasizes safety, ergonomics, and performance in physical and operational contexts, while User Experience Research centers on digital interfaces and user satisfaction. Both roles are vital in their respective industries and often require similar educational backgrounds, but their application areas distinguish them.
